
要掌握Vue.js的最佳时间因人而异,但通常来说,1、如果你已经有前端开发经验,34周内你可以掌握Vue.js的基础知识和应用;2、如果你是新手,通常需要23个月的时间来熟悉和掌握Vue.js。
一、学习Vue.js的前提条件
- HTML和CSS:Vue.js的核心是前端开发,因此你需要掌握HTML和CSS来构建网页的结构和样式。
- JavaScript基础:Vue.js是基于JavaScript的框架,所以你需要理解JavaScript的基本概念,如变量、函数、对象和数组等。
- 其他前端框架经验:如果你有React或Angular的开发经验,学习Vue.js会更加容易,因为这些框架有很多相似之处。
二、Vue.js学习路径
-
基础知识学习(1-2周):
- Vue实例:学习Vue实例的创建和生命周期。
- 模板语法:掌握Vue的模板语法,包括插值、指令等。
- 计算属性和侦听器:理解计算属性和侦听器的用法。
- 条件渲染和列表渲染:学习如何使用条件和列表渲染来动态显示数据。
-
组件化开发(2-3周):
- 组件基础:了解组件的创建和使用。
- 组件之间的通信:掌握父子组件、兄弟组件、跨级组件之间的通信方法。
- 插槽(Slot):学习插槽的使用,尤其是具名插槽和作用域插槽。
-
Vue Router和Vuex(3-4周):
- Vue Router:学习Vue Router来实现单页面应用的路由功能。
- Vuex:掌握Vuex来进行状态管理,理解核心概念如State、Getter、Mutation和Action。
三、实战项目
-
小型项目(1-2周):
- 任务管理系统:创建一个简单的任务管理系统,包括任务的添加、编辑和删除功能。
- 个人博客:开发一个个人博客系统,实现文章的发布、编辑和删除功能。
-
中型项目(2-3个月):
- 电商网站:开发一个电商网站,包含用户注册登录、商品展示、购物车和订单管理等功能。
- 社交平台:创建一个社交平台,用户可以发布动态、评论、点赞和关注其他用户。
四、深入学习和优化
-
性能优化(1-2周):
- 懒加载:使用懒加载来优化页面加载速度。
- 虚拟列表:在大量数据渲染时使用虚拟列表来提高性能。
- 代码拆分:通过代码拆分来减少首屏加载时间。
-
测试和部署(1-2周):
- 单元测试:学习如何编写单元测试来确保代码的质量。
- 集成测试:掌握集成测试的编写方法,确保不同模块之间的协作正常。
- 部署:了解如何将Vue.js项目部署到生产环境中。
五、持续学习和社区参与
- 参与开源项目:通过参与开源项目来提升自己的编码能力和项目经验。
- 阅读官方文档:Vue.js的官方文档非常详细,定期阅读可以帮助你掌握最新的功能和最佳实践。
- 加入社区:参加Vue.js相关的社区活动,如论坛、线下沙龙等,与其他开发者交流经验。
总结:要掌握Vue.js的时间取决于你的前端开发基础和学习投入的时间。如果你已经有前端开发经验,可以在34周内掌握基础知识并开始开发小型项目。如果你是新手,可能需要23个月的时间来熟悉和掌握Vue.js。通过实践项目、性能优化和持续学习,你可以不断提升自己的Vue.js开发能力。
相关问答FAQs:
1. 什么是Vue.js?
Vue.js是一个用于构建用户界面的渐进式JavaScript框架。它被设计成易于理解和开发的,使开发者能够快速构建交互式的单页面应用(SPA)和动态网页。Vue.js具有轻量级、高效和灵活的特点,它通过组件化的方式将页面划分为独立的可重用模块,使得代码更具可维护性。
2. 我应该何时开始学习Vue.js?
学习Vue.js的最佳时间取决于您的需求和背景。如果您已经熟悉基本的HTML、CSS和JavaScript,那么现在就可以开始学习Vue.js了。Vue.js相对于其他框架来说学习曲线较低,因此即使是初学者也可以迅速上手。如果您想要构建交互式的单页面应用或者需要提高开发效率,那么学习Vue.js将会是一个明智的选择。
3. 学习Vue.js需要多长时间才能掌握?
学习Vue.js需要的时间因个人的学习速度和经验而有所不同。对于有前端开发经验的开发者来说,掌握Vue.js可能只需要几周或几个月的时间。然而,对于初学者来说,可能需要更长的时间来理解和应用Vue.js的概念和技术。建议通过阅读官方文档、参与在线课程和实践项目来加速学习进度。通过不断练习和实践,您将能够更好地掌握Vue.js并将其应用到实际项目中。
文章包含AI辅助创作:什么时间能好vue,发布者:fiy,转载请注明出处:https://worktile.com/kb/p/3584186
微信扫一扫
支付宝扫一扫